
Retail Client Merchandiser (Temporary)
Acosta Sales & Marketing, Attleboro, MA, United States
You will gain hands‑on experience supporting well‑known consumer brands in retail stores during an 8–12‑week assignment.
As a Retail Client Merchandiser, you’ll build displays, support product launches, and partner with store teams to drive strong in‑store execution.
Responsibilities
Build and maintain
in‑store displays and promotions
Support new product launches
and shelf compliance
Partner
with store managers to support sales goals
Work
independently
across assigned retail locations
Qualifications
High School Diploma/GED required
College students
or recent grads encouraged to apply
Retail, customer service, or sales experience
preferred
Able to
lift up to 30 lbs
and
travel locally
Valid driver’s license
